So I migrated most of my configuration from OH2 to OH3.1. I generally use HABPanel for my daily interactions with the devices since I haven’t figured out the newer floor plans and stuff in the new interface.
I had some problems with MQTT disconnecting and reconnecting which I traced to the system broker having a config. I purged the cache and temp folder then brought OH back online which fixed things… sort of.
After purging /var/lib/openhab/cache and /var/lib/openhab/tmp I couldn’t pull up HABPanel. Instead I get a Sorry resource not found message along with the following info.
Debug information Url: /habpanel/index.html Path: /habpanel/index.html Hash: Params: Query: Route: (.*)
So I went to Settings > User Interfaces to see what was going on. It said “No user interfaces installed yet”. I clicked on Add then on HABPanel to get it to install. It just sits there with with installing, but never finishes. If I reload the user interfaces options it still says “No user interfaces installed yet”. Clicking add again still has HABPanel but this time it doesn’t say installing.
This is what it looked like when I clicked HABPanel to reinstall.
I looked through openhab.log and it doesn’t mention HABPanel except for it stopping yesterday.
2021-09-27 22:52:48.792 [INFO ] [ab.ui.habpanel.internal.HABPanelTile] - Started HABPanel at /habpanel 2021-09-27 22:53:46.573 [INFO ] [ab.ui.habpanel.internal.HABPanelTile] - Stopped HABPanel
So now I’m out of ideas of what to try next. I’m guessing it is in some sort of inconsistent state where it is installed but missing something that makes it think it is installed.
- Obligatory Platform information:
- Hardware: Raspberry Pi 3 B+
- OS: Raspbian Buster
- Java Runtime Environment: OpenJDK Runtime Environment Zulu11.50+19-CA (build 11.0.12+7-LTS)
- openHAB version: 3.1.0